+# Workflow that builds, tests and then pushes the app docker images to the ghcr.io repository
+name: Build and Publish App Image
+
+
+# Always run on "main"
+# Always run on tags
+# Always run on PRs
+# Can also be triggered manually
+on:
+  push:
+    branches:
+      - main
+    tags:
+      - '*'
+  pull_request:
+  workflow_dispatch:
+    inputs:
+      reason:
+        description: 'Reason for manual trigger'
+        required: true
+        default: ''
+
+jobs:
+  # Builds the OpenDevin Docker images
+  ghcr_build:
+    name: Build App Image
+    runs-on: ubuntu-latest
+    outputs:
+      tags: ${{ steps.capture-tags.outputs.tags }}
+    permissions:
+      contents: read
+      packages: write
+    strategy:
+      matrix:
+        image: ['opendevin']
+        platform: ['amd64', 'arm64']
+    steps:
+      - name: Checkout
+        uses: actions/checkout@v4
+      - name: Free Disk Space (Ubuntu)
+        uses: jlumbroso/free-disk-space@main
+        with:
+          # this might remove tools that are actually needed,
+          # if set to "true" but frees about 6 GB
+          tool-cache: true
+          # all of these default to true, but feel free to set to
+          # "false" if necessary for your workflow
+          android: true
+          dotnet: true
+          haskell: true
+          large-packages: true
+          docker-images: false
+          swap-storage: true
+      - name: Set up QEMU
+        uses: docker/setup-qemu-action@v3
+      - name: Set up Docker Buildx
+        id: buildx
+        uses: docker/setup-buildx-action@v3
+      - name: Build and export image
+        id: build
+        run: ./containers/build.sh ${{ matrix.image }} ${{ github.repository_owner }} ${{ matrix.platform }}
+      - name: Capture tags
+        id: capture-tags
+        run: |
+          tags=$(cat tags.txt)
+          echo "tags=$tags"
+          echo "tags=$tags" >> $GITHUB_OUTPUT
+      - name: Upload Docker image as artifact
+        uses: actions/upload-artifact@v4
+        with:
+          name: ${{ matrix.image }}_image_${{ matrix.platform }}
+          path: /tmp/${{ matrix.image }}_image_${{ matrix.platform }}.tar
+          retention-days: 14
+
+  # Push the OpenDevin and sandbox Docker images to the ghcr.io repository
+  ghcr_push:
+    runs-on: ubuntu-latest
+    needs: [ghcr_build]
+    if: github.ref == 'refs/heads/main' || startsWith(github.ref, 'refs/tags/') || (github.event_name == 'pull_request' && github.event.pull_request.merged == true && github.event.pull_request.base.ref == 'main')
+    env:
+      tags: ${{ needs.ghcr_build.outputs.tags }}
+    permissions:
+      contents: read
+      packages: write
+    strategy:
+      matrix:
+        image: ['opendevin']
+        platform: ['amd64', 'arm64']
+    steps:
+      - name: Checkout code
+        uses: actions/checkout@v4
+      - name: Login to GHCR
+        uses: docker/login-action@v3
+        with:
+          registry: ghcr.io
+          username: ${{ github.repository_owner }}
+          password: ${{ secrets.GITHUB_TOKEN }}
+      - name: Download Docker images
+        uses: actions/download-artifact@v4
+        with:
+          name: ${{ matrix.image }}_image_${{ matrix.platform }}
+          path: /tmp/${{ matrix.platform }}
+      - name: Load images and push to registry
+        run: |
+          mv /tmp/${{ matrix.platform }}/${{ matrix.image }}_image_${{ matrix.platform }}.tar .
+          loaded_image=$(docker load -i ${{ matrix.image }}_image_${{ matrix.platform }}.tar | grep "Loaded image:" | head -n 1 | awk '{print $3}')
+          echo "loaded image = $loaded_image"
+          tags=$(echo ${tags} | tr ' ' '\n')
+          image_name=$(echo "ghcr.io/${{ github.repository_owner }}/${{ matrix.image }}" | tr '[:upper:]' '[:lower:]')
+          echo "image name = $image_name"
+          for tag in $tags; do
+            echo "tag = $tag"
+            docker tag $loaded_image $image_name:${tag}_${{ matrix.platform }}
+            docker push $image_name:${tag}_${{ matrix.platform }}
+          done
+  # Creates and pushes the OpenDevin and sandbox Docker image manifests
+  create_manifest:
+    runs-on: ubuntu-latest
+    needs: [ghcr_build, ghcr_push]
+    if: github.ref == 'refs/heads/main' || startsWith(github.ref, 'refs/tags/') || (github.event_name == 'pull_request' && github.event.pull_request.merged == true && github.event.pull_request.base.ref == 'main')
+    env:
+      tags: ${{ needs.ghcr_build.outputs.tags }}
+    strategy:
+      matrix:
+        image: ['opendevin']
+    permissions:
+      contents: read
+      packages: write
+    steps:
+      - name: Checkout code
+        uses: actions/checkout@v4
+      - name: Login to GHCR
+        uses: docker/login-action@v3
+        with:
+          registry: ghcr.io
+          username: ${{ github.repository_owner }}
+          password: ${{ secrets.GITHUB_TOKEN }}
+      - name: Create and push multi-platform manifest
+        run: |
+          image_name=$(echo "ghcr.io/${{ github.repository_owner }}/${{ matrix.image }}" | tr '[:upper:]' '[:lower:]')
+          echo "image name = $image_name"
+          tags=$(echo ${tags} | tr ' ' '\n')
+          for tag in $tags; do
+            echo 'tag = $tag'
+            docker buildx imagetools create --tag $image_name:$tag \
+              $image_name:${tag}_amd64 \
+              $image_name:${tag}_arm64
+          done
